What is investment performance?

Investment performance refers to the measurement of how well an investment or a portfolio of investments achieves its financial objectives over a specific period of time. It is typically evaluated by calculating returns, such as total return, annualized return, or risk-adjusted return, and comparing them to relevant benchmarks or goals. Investment performance analysis helps investors and fund managers assess the effectiveness of their investment strategies and make informed decisions about future asset allocation.

What are some common challenges faced by professionals in investment performance roles, and how can they be addressed?

Professionals in Investment Performance often encounter challenges such as ensuring data accuracy, meeting tight reporting deadlines, and interpreting complex investment results for various stakeholders. Addressing these challenges requires strong attention to detail, effective communication with portfolio managers and data teams, and the use of robust performance measurement tools. Staying current with industry standards like GIPS (Global Investment Performance Standards) and fostering a collaborative environment can also help in overcoming these hurdles and delivering high-quality performance analysis.

What is the difference between Investment Performance vs Investment Analyst?

AspectInvestment PerformanceInvestment Analyst
Primary FocusMeasuring and analyzing the returns of investmentsResearching and evaluating investment opportunities
Required SkillsData analysis, performance metrics, financial modelingFinancial analysis, market research, valuation techniques
CertificationsNone specifically required, but CFA can be beneficialCFA, CFA Level I or II often preferred
Work EnvironmentPerformance reporting teams, asset management firmsResearch departments, investment firms, banks

Investment Performance focuses on assessing how well investments perform over time, while Investment Analysts evaluate potential investments to inform decision-making. Both roles require financial analysis skills, but their core responsibilities differ: one measures past results, the other predicts future opportunities.

Job description


The Lead Investment Accountant job provides expertise and leads the review of accounting policies and procedures, ensuring they are correctly applied to financial transactions. This job works directly with asset management, portfolio management and acquisition/disposition teams. In addition, this job guides a team to prepare month end closing reports and subsidiary quarterly financial analytics, and reports to senior management ensuring accurate asset evaluations.
Key Responsibilities and Duties
  • Reviews Generally Accepted Accounting Principles (GAAP) work papers and supporting schedules to satisfy all investment accounting requirements for internal and external audits.
  • Identifies key financial takeaways and information for joint ventures to ensure compliance with investment accounting policies and procedures (sales, acquisitions, debt refinancing, real estate investment trust (REI) restructuring and financial performance).
  • Reviews frequent and ad hoc financial inquiries into the monthly and quarterly reports, adding value by providing management insight into the activities of the underlying properties.
  • Analyzes calculated unlevered and levered, gross and net portfolio performance returns and property internal rates of return.
  • Provides expertise and advice on modified cash basis accounting information provided by third party management firms to accrual basis to facilitate preparation of fair value GAAP basis financial statements.
  • Manages large processes in reporting and investment accounts, along with guiding and mentoring lower level professionals.
